Chris Tofalos is official photographer to Bolton Wanderers Football Club and has been for the last two seasons.
1995/6 wasn't a happy time. Bruce Rioch quit the club after guiding them to the Premier League and it was already too late to stop relegation when Colin Todd was made sole manager.
1996/7 has been a different story. Some clever buying and selling resulted in the club having a stronger squad and millions in the bank! The team clinched the championship as runaway leaders and ended 18 points above their nearest rivals, Barnsley. A fantastic achievement.
Now for the Premier League, but this time...
